stimulating growth of magnetotactic bacteria by culturing the bacteria in a culture medium for magnetotactic bacteria into which at least one chelating agent is added, said chelating agent being selected from the group consisting of:\n
chelating agents having one or more phosphonate groups,\n
chelating agents having one or more ketone groups,\n
chelating agents having one or more sulfonate groups,\n
rhodamine B, ascorbic acid, folic acid, a low-molecular weight dextran, anthranilic acid, porphyrin rings of hemoglobin, alendronate, calcein, erythrosine, and 3-[cyclohexylamino]1 -propanesulfonic acid (CAPS),\n
